If you are not after the edge line computer power, this processor is a good cheap solution. Many DDR2-type Intel chipset motherboard fitted with Intel Core 2 Duo gives user an option to upgrade CPU to Intel Core 2 Quad Processor, like this one. Therefore, the processor may be a cheapest solution to enter the quad-core realm. With good 12M cache and 1333 MHz bus speed, it give a noticeable gain in power, e g. comparing with Intel Core 2 Duo 3.0 GHz.

Good CPU for its age, it handles games well when paired with a GTX580 on a 780 Striker II Formula and 4GB DDR2 1066 2.83GHz, 12MB Cache, 1333 FSB, Quad Core. 3dmark06 score of 16,710 with no overclocking is quite impressive. I tested this against an AMD Phenom 9600 quad core with only a score of 10,356.
